Summary

CVE-2021-45067 is a medium-severity Access of Memory Location After End of Buffer (CWE-788) vulnerability in Adobe Acrobat Dc. Its CVSS base score is 5.5 (Medium).

Operationally, ranked in the top 19.4%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og.

Vulnerability details

Acrobat Reader DC version 21.007.20099 (and earlier), 20.004.30017 (and earlier) and 17.011.30204 (and earlier) are affected by an Access of Memory Location After End of Buffer vulnerability that could lead to disclosure of sensitive memory. An attacker could leverage this…

more

vulnerability to bypass mitigations such as ASLR. Exploitation of this issue requires user interaction in that a victim must open a malicious file.
